I didn't know if I should continue the Alemite thread I started or start this one.
Anyway,the adapter you put on the end of a grease gun that has Alemite on one end and regular on the other, puts more grease outside the joint than it does where the grease is supposed to go! In order to get this problem corrected, I took mine to a machine shop and had them lop off the regular fitting side and thread it to match the grease gun hose threads. This way,I doesn't leak as bad when you start pumping grease into the joint.

I bought one of those a Zerk that snaps onto a standard Zerk coupler and the other end is a Alemite coupling. Import made for Gary Wallace at $25, probably China made. The alimite worked on the first two fittings then began leaking like crazy, the small brown washer came out and the thing never worked again for me, I had to fasten the junky thing in a vise to get it to release it's hold on my grease gun.
I gave up and bought a handful of good old Zerk fittings from NAPA and pulled the Alemites and replaced them with modern type (60 year old)Zerks...so much for being "old timey" but I can do a grease job without having grease all over me and the floor of the shop.
